Why does the human animal need answers so badly?
Philosophy, Chaos & You is not a history of philosophy. It is an examination of the wound beneath it.
The world exceeds the organism. Perception reduces it. Language divides it. Meaning makes it survivable. Then the explanations we build for orientation begin demanding loyalty. The map becomes a doctrine. The doctrine becomes an identity. The identity becomes a fortress.
From Plato, the Stoics, Descartes, Kant, Nietzsche, Kierkegaard, Camus, and Wittgenstein to the modern worlds of ideology, productivity, social media, self-improvement, and endless public performance, this book asks what happens when thought stops helping us navigate reality and begins replacing it.
Why do we defend ideas as though they were extensions of the body?
Why does uncertainty feel like danger?
Why do we keep searching for one final system, one decisive explanation, or one sentence capable of making the wound close cleanly?
What happens when the answer stops working?
Written in seven increasingly self-aware circles, Philosophy, Chaos & You turns the framework inward. It questions the author, the reader, the audience inside the skull, and the seductive belief that greater explanation automatically means greater freedom.
This book will not answer your questions.
It may make it harder to hide inside the answers.
